Public Toilets nearby 50 Acacia Avenue, Riccarton, Christchurch, New Zealand

Church Corner (Christchurch)

Approximately 0.7 km away
Address: New Zealand

Riccarton Rd (Christchurch)

Approximately 1.79 km away
Address: New Zealand